We're seeking a Hardware Engineering Manager to lead a highly skilled hardware engineering team and play a pivotal role in an ongoing engineering transformation. This is a senior leadership position with significant influence over technical direction, team capability, and cross‑functional collaboration. While this is not a hands‑on design role, the successful candidate must bring strong technical foundations and deep experience across the full lifecycle of hardware development - from hardware architecture and PCB layout through manufacturing, bring‑up, and design proving for complete electronic systems (CPU, memory, power). Expertise in Intel x86 or ARM‑based architectures is highly desirable. This role is ideal for someone who thrives on guiding talented engineers, asking the right technical questions, facilitating problem‑solving, and ensuring decisions are made with a holistic, system‑level mindset.

Key Responsibilities for the Hardware Engineering Manager:

  • Lead, manage, and develop a high‑performing hardware engineering team
  • Provide technical oversight and challenge, ensuring robust decision‑making
  • Facilitate problem‑solving sessions and guide engineers through complex issues
  • Ensure hardware decisions consider impacts across mechanical, software, and manufacturing disciplines
  • Drive alignment and engagement across cross‑functional teams from early design phases
  • Support the organisation's engineering transformation by contributing to senior leadership discussions and strategy
  • Oversee the end‑to‑end lifecycle of hardware development, ensuring quality, reliability, and timely delivery
  • Build and maintain a strong engineering culture focused on collaboration, accountability, and continuous improvement

What You'll Bring:

  • Strong technical background in hardware/electronics engineering
  • Extensive experience across hardware design lifecycle: PCB layout, manufacturing, bring‑up, validation, and system proving
  • Expertise with Intel x86 or ARM architectures (highly advantageous)
  • Ability to guide and challenge engineers through intelligent questioning and structured thinking
  • Experience collaborating across mechanical, software, and manufacturing teams
  • Proven leadership experience — or strong technical foundations with readiness to step into senior leadership
  • Confidence managing highly skilled engineers and navigating the unique challenges of senior technical teams
  • Clear communication skills and a calm, structured leadership style
